The Registered Nurse – CVICU provides specialized nursing care to critically ill patients in the cardiovascular medical and surgical intensive care unit. This role requires advanced clinical skills to manage complex cardiac conditions, including patients with mechanical circulatory support devices. The RN will collaborate with physicians, surgeons, and interdisciplinary teams to deliver safe, evidence-based care in a high-acuity environment.
Key Responsibilities
Provide comprehensive nursing care to critically ill cardiac patients in the CVICU
Safely manage a patient assignment of up to two ICU patients
Monitor, assess, and document patient conditions, including hemodynamic status and cardiac rhythms
Administer medications, IV therapies, and blood products as prescribed
Operate and manage advanced cardiac devices such as Impella and intra-aortic balloon pump (IABP)
Support patients requiring renal replacement therapy, including NxStage systems
Respond promptly to emergencies and perform life-saving interventions
Collaborate with physicians, advanced practice providers, and other healthcare professionals to develop and implement individualized care plans
Maintain compliance with hospital policies, infection control standards, and regulatory requirements
Required Qualifications
Current RN license in the state of practice
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) or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) with commitment to obtain BSN
Minimum of 1–2 years of ICU nursing experience
Strong clinical assessment and critical thinking skills
Ability to work 12-hour shifts, including nights, weekends, and holidays
Preferred Qualifications (if any)
Current experience managing Impella and IABP devices
NxStage training and experience with continuous renal replacement therapy (CRRT)
Prior experience in a CVICU or cardiac surgical ICU setting
Certifications (if any)
Basic Life Support (BLS) – required
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) – required
Critical Care Registered Nurse (CCRN) – preferred
